Climate modelling and ecological study benefit immensely from quantum computing's ability to handle substantial datasets and intricate interactions that define Earth climate's systems. Weather forecast structures involve many of variables interacting across various ranges, from molecular-level atmospheric chemistry to worldwide circulation patterns covering significant distances. Traditional supercomputers, while powerful, struggle with the computational requirements of high-resolution climate models that could offer more accurate extended forecasts. Quantum processors hold the opportunity to transform our comprehension of climate systems by facilitating much more sophisticated simulations that consider previously intractable interactions between atmospheric, marine, and earthbound systems. These advanced models might provide essential insights for addressing environmental adaptation, improving disaster readiness, and creating more effective environmental policies. Scientists are particularly excited about quantum computing's potential to enhance renewable energy systems, from improving solar panel efficiency to enhancing battery storage capacity, akin to innovations like Northvolt's Voltpack system might gain advantage from. The technology's capacity to address intricate optimisation problems is vital for designing effective energy distribution networks and storagement solutions.

The pharmaceutical market stands as one of the most promising recipients of quantum computer advancements, specifically in medicine exploration and molecular modelling applications. Conventional computational techniques frequently deal with the intricate quantum mechanical communications that regulate molecular behaviour, necessitating significant handling power and time to simulate even straightforward compounds. Quantum processors stand out at these calculations since they operate on quantum mechanical concepts themselves, making them naturally suited for designing molecular communications, protein folding, and chemical reactions. Leading pharmaceutical companies are progressively investing in quantum computer collaborations to expedite their r & d processes, recognising that these technologies can reduce medicine discovery timelines from years to years. The capacity to replicate molecular behaviour with unparalleled precision creates opportunities for developing much more efficient drugs with less negative effects. Quantum algorithms can discover large chemical spaces much more effectively than classical computers, possibly uncovering promising drug candidates that could or else be overlooked. Financial services represent a different industry experiencing substantial evolution via quantum computer applications, notably in risk evaluation, investment optimisation, and fraud detection systems. The intricate mathematical models that underpin contemporary finance entail countless variables and limits that challenge even the most effective classical systems. Quantum algorithms show particular prowess in optimisation problems, which are integral to investment management, trading strategies, and risk assessment procedures. Financial institutions are exploring quantum enhancements to improve their ability to handle large amounts of market data in real-time, enabling much more sophisticated analysis of market trends and financial opportunities. The technology's ability for parallel processing enables the simultaneous evaluation of multiple situations, offering comprehensive threat evaluations and investment strategy approaches. Quantum machine learning algorithms are showing promise in identifying fraudulent deals by pinpointing subtle patterns that might elude traditional discovery methods efficiently.

AI and machine learning engagements are seeing remarkable acceleration via connection with quantum computing enhancements, establishing new opportunities for pattern recognition, data evaluation, and automated decision-making steps. Conventional machine learning algorithms frequently face limits when handling high-dimensional data or complex optimization landscapes that require extensive computational resources to explore efficiently. Quantum machine learning algorithms use quantum phenomena like superposition and entanglement . to navigate solution areas much more efficiently than their classical counterparts. These quantum-enhanced algorithms offer potential in varied domains such as natural language management, graphics recognition, and forecast analytics, potentially utilized by devices like Anysphere's Cursor. The blend of quantum computing with artificial intelligence is fabricating hybrid systems capable of addressing problems once considered computationally unfeasible. Scientists create quantum neural networks that could possibly learn and accommodate more efficiently than conventional structures, while quantum algorithms for unsupervised learning are showcasing potential in unearthing concealed patterns within extensive datasets. This amalgamation of quantum technology and AI signifies a core change in how we approach challenging data evaluation and automatic deliberation tasks, with implications stretching across essentially every field within the modern market.
